This is an automated email from the ASF dual-hosted git repository.

markt pushed a change to branch main
in repository https://gitbox.apache.org/repos/asf/tomcat.git.


    from e1cef2c  Tighten up for partial roles and groups configuration
     new fbd85f4  Update internal fork of Commons Pool to 2.11.1
     new d2e8a3b4 Update internal fork of Commons DBCP to 2.9.0 (2021-08-03)

The 2 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ails.  The revisions
listed as "add" were already present in the repository and have only
been added to this reference.


Summary of changes:
 MERGE.txt                                          |    4 +-
 .../apache/tomcat/dbcp/dbcp2/AbandonedTrace.java   |   33 +-
 .../apache/tomcat/dbcp/dbcp2/BasicDataSource.java  |  643 ++++--
 .../tomcat/dbcp/dbcp2/BasicDataSourceFactory.java  |  521 ++---
 .../tomcat/dbcp/dbcp2/BasicDataSourceMXBean.java   |  330 +--
 .../dbcp/dbcp2/ConnectionFactoryFactory.java       |    2 +-
 java/org/apache/tomcat/dbcp/dbcp2/Constants.java   |   16 +-
 .../dbcp/dbcp2/DataSourceConnectionFactory.java    |    2 +-
 ...DataSourceMXBean.java => DataSourceMXBean.java} |  284 ++-
 .../tomcat/dbcp/dbcp2/DelegatingConnection.java    |  866 +++----
 .../dbcp/dbcp2/DelegatingDatabaseMetaData.java     |   19 +-
 .../tomcat/dbcp/dbcp2/DelegatingResultSet.java     |   24 +-
 .../tomcat/dbcp/dbcp2/DelegatingStatement.java     |   19 +-
 .../org/apache/tomcat/dbcp/dbcp2/Jdbc41Bridge.java |  136 +-
 java/org/apache/tomcat/dbcp/dbcp2/PStmtKey.java    |    4 +-
 .../dbcp/dbcp2/PoolableCallableStatement.java      |   30 +-
 .../tomcat/dbcp/dbcp2/PoolableConnection.java      |  283 ++-
 .../dbcp/dbcp2/PoolableConnectionFactory.java      |  171 +-
 .../dbcp/dbcp2/PoolableConnectionMXBean.java       |   44 +-
 .../dbcp/dbcp2/PoolablePreparedStatement.java      |   20 +-
 .../tomcat/dbcp/dbcp2/PoolingConnection.java       |   68 +-
 .../tomcat/dbcp/dbcp2/PoolingDataSource.java       |  183 +-
 .../apache/tomcat/dbcp/dbcp2/PoolingDriver.java    |  225 +-
 java/org/apache/tomcat/dbcp/dbcp2/Utils.java       |   52 +-
 .../dbcp/dbcp2/cpdsadapter/ConnectionImpl.java     |  106 +-
 .../dbcp/dbcp2/cpdsadapter/DriverAdapterCPDS.java  |  193 +-
 .../dbcp2/cpdsadapter/PooledConnectionImpl.java    |  110 +-
 .../dbcp2/datasources/CPDSConnectionFactory.java   |  426 ++--
 .../tomcat/dbcp/dbcp2/datasources/CharArray.java   |   88 +
 .../dbcp2/datasources/InstanceKeyDataSource.java   | 1220 +++++-----
 .../datasources/InstanceKeyDataSourceFactory.java  |  226 +-
 .../datasources/KeyedCPDSConnectionFactory.java    |  335 +--
 .../dbcp2/datasources/PerUserPoolDataSource.java   |  343 ++-
 .../datasources/PerUserPoolDataSourceFactory.java  |   65 +-
 .../tomcat/dbcp/dbcp2/datasources/PoolKey.java     |    2 +-
 .../dbcp2/datasources/PooledConnectionAndInfo.java |   55 +-
 .../dbcp2/datasources/PooledConnectionManager.java |   30 +-
 .../dbcp2/datasources/SharedPoolDataSource.java    |  104 +-
 .../datasources/SharedPoolDataSourceFactory.java   |   10 +-
 .../tomcat/dbcp/dbcp2/datasources/UserPassKey.java |   53 +-
 .../dbcp/dbcp2/managed/BasicManagedDataSource.java |  227 +-
 .../managed/DataSourceXAConnectionFactory.java     |   45 +-
 .../dbcp2/managed/LocalXAConnectionFactory.java    |   39 +-
 .../dbcp/dbcp2/managed/ManagedConnection.java      |   36 +-
 .../dbcp/dbcp2/managed/ManagedDataSource.java      |   29 +-
 .../managed/PoolableManagedConnectionFactory.java  |    3 +-
 .../dbcp/dbcp2/managed/TransactionContext.java     |  181 +-
 .../dbcp2/managed/TransactionContextListener.java  |   29 +-
 .../dbcp/dbcp2/managed/TransactionRegistry.java    |  134 +-
 .../dbcp/dbcp2/managed/XAConnectionFactory.java    |   45 +-
 .../dbcp/pool2/BaseKeyedPooledObjectFactory.java   |   70 +-
 .../apache/tomcat/dbcp/pool2/BaseObjectPool.java   |   84 +-
 .../tomcat/dbcp/pool2/BasePooledObjectFactory.java |   53 +-
 java/org/apache/tomcat/dbcp/pool2/DestroyMode.java |   10 +-
 .../apache/tomcat/dbcp/pool2/KeyedObjectPool.java  |   23 +-
 .../dbcp/pool2/KeyedPooledObjectFactory.java       |   58 +-
 java/org/apache/tomcat/dbcp/pool2/ObjectPool.java  |   14 +-
 java/org/apache/tomcat/dbcp/pool2/PoolUtils.java   | 2360 ++++++++++----------
 .../org/apache/tomcat/dbcp/pool2/PooledObject.java |  308 ++-
 .../tomcat/dbcp/pool2/PooledObjectFactory.java     |   48 +-
 .../tomcat/dbcp/pool2/PooledObjectState.java       |   28 +-
 .../dbcp/pool2/SwallowedExceptionListener.java     |    2 +-
 java/org/apache/tomcat/dbcp/pool2/TrackedUse.java  |   30 +-
 .../apache/tomcat/dbcp/pool2/UsageTracking.java    |   15 +-
 .../tomcat/dbcp/pool2/impl/AbandonedConfig.java    |  325 +--
 .../dbcp/pool2/impl/BaseGenericObjectPool.java     | 2279 +++++++++++--------
 .../dbcp/pool2/impl/BaseObjectPoolConfig.java      |  906 +++++---
 .../apache/tomcat/dbcp/pool2/impl/CallStack.java   |   24 +-
 .../tomcat/dbcp/pool2/impl/CallStackUtils.java     |    2 +-
 .../dbcp/pool2/impl/DefaultEvictionPolicy.java     |   33 +-
 .../dbcp/pool2/impl/DefaultPooledObject.java       |  321 +--
 .../dbcp/pool2/impl/DefaultPooledObjectInfo.java   |   38 +-
 .../pool2/impl/DefaultPooledObjectInfoMBean.java   |   47 +-
 .../tomcat/dbcp/pool2/impl/EvictionConfig.java     |  139 +-
 .../tomcat/dbcp/pool2/impl/EvictionTimer.java      |  206 +-
 .../dbcp/pool2/impl/GenericKeyedObjectPool.java    | 1910 ++++++++--------
 .../pool2/impl/GenericKeyedObjectPoolConfig.java   |  102 +-
 .../pool2/impl/GenericKeyedObjectPoolMXBean.java   |  217 +-
 .../tomcat/dbcp/pool2/impl/GenericObjectPool.java  | 1197 +++++-----
 .../dbcp/pool2/impl/GenericObjectPoolConfig.java   |   72 +-
 .../dbcp/pool2/impl/GenericObjectPoolMXBean.java   |  206 +-
 .../pool2/impl/InterruptibleReentrantLock.java     |   10 +-
 .../dbcp/pool2/impl/LinkedBlockingDeque.java       | 1671 +++++++-------
 .../tomcat/dbcp/pool2/impl/NoOpCallStack.java      |    8 +-
 .../tomcat/dbcp/pool2/impl/PoolImplUtils.java      |  125 +-
 .../dbcp/pool2/impl/PooledSoftReference.java       |   39 +-
 .../dbcp/pool2/impl/SecurityManagerCallStack.java  |  104 +-
 .../dbcp/pool2/impl/SoftReferenceObjectPool.java   |  396 ++--
 .../tomcat/dbcp/pool2/impl/ThrowableCallStack.java |   41 +-
 webapps/docs/changelog.xml                         |    8 +
 90 files changed, 11841 insertions(+), 9801 deletions(-)
 copy java/org/apache/tomcat/dbcp/dbcp2/{BasicDataSourceMXBean.java => 
DataSourceMXBean.java} (62%)
 create mode 100644 java/org/apache/tomcat/dbcp/dbcp2/datasources/CharArray.java

---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scr...@tomcat.apache.org
For additional commands, e-mail: dev-h...@tomcat.apache.org

Reply via email to